A really great piece this and if you like daggers in their untouched state, this could be for you. This early SA dagger came from Scotland this week, after I was contacted by a very nice lady up there.
Left to her by her father, it’s not been touched since 1945! I am not sure where he kept it, but the amount of patina etc on it is huge. However, it has not damaged anything. All the nickel fittings are dirty and have gone a dark yellow. The grip is perfect, just dirty and the eagle and SA button are perfect. The scabbard has lost the original lacquer but all the brown anodising is there. The original short hanger and nickel snap clip are in great condition. Totally untouched. The blade is actually very good. No damage and extremely bright. There are a few age smudges to the surfaces but no pitting and no edge nicks. The dagger was made by HAMMERSFAR CIE- SOLINGEN and features their distinctive ‘swimming man’ logo. The lower crossguard is Gau marked No for Nordsee, so this dagger came from the North sea coast. This maker is rated as about a 7/10 on the rarity scale, with 10/10 being the rarest. Great dagger!
